통합 과학 과정의 접근 방법에 관한 비교 연구 - 개념 중심 방법과 과정 중심 접근 방법을 중심으로 - (On Approaches to Integrated Science Curriculum - About the concept centered approach and the process centered approach -)

  • In this study, concept centered approach and process centered approach in developing integrated science curriculum were compared and compromised between two approaches. It seems that two approaches are in antagonistic relations. The superficial conflictions getween two approaches are not because they are antagonistic in their nature, but because their interesting points are different. The concept centered approahc is interest in fundamental scientific concepts and the process centered approach is interested in scientific enquiry. If science is the composition of enquiry processes and concepts produced by enquiry processes, scientific enquiry process and scientific concept must not be inconsistant. Although concepts are not unchangeable, new concepts and advanced concepts are based on the old concepts. Enquiry activity which is not based on concepts also cannot be significant enquiry. Although fundamental concepts in science is very important, in order to apply concepts to varios phenomena, and to understand concepts more deeply the student should understand concept through the process by which the concepts are derived. As we have discussed above, only the concept centered approach or the process centered approach itself is not complete. Comparing these two uncomplete approaches to integrated science curriculum, we can find out that two approaches are in complementary relations. Because integrated science is based on the idea that natural phenomena should not be understood in fragments, but should be understood as mutually related system' the integrated science curriculum includes both the fundamental scientific concepts and scientific enquiry processes.

  • This paper is an attempt to propose a new model of intonation called 'Configurational Contour Model'. For our purpose two previous models are discussed : one is the system of tonetic-stress marks and the other is the theory of pitch levels. To overcome shortcomings which these approaches display, the new model is based on two fundamental characteristics of intonation: (1) that intonation is a suprasyllabic phenomenon; and (2) that intonation is basically a matter of configurations, i.e., of rising, falling and level. Accordingly, the new model can be relatable to relevant aspects of the phonetic representation of utterances and also can express all the tonal oppositions in a given language.

  • Triple-negative breast cancers (TNBC), characterized by absence of the estrogen receptor (ER) and progesterone receptor (PR) and lack of overexpression of human epidermal growth factor receptor 2 (HER2), have a poor prognosis. To overcome therapy limitations of TNBC, various new approaches are needed. This mini-review focuses on discovery of new targets and drugs which might offer new hope for TNBC patients.

  • Due to the rapidly growing complexity of VLSI circuits, test methodologies based on delay testing become popular. However, most approaches cannot handle custom logic blocks which are described by logic functions rather than by circuit primitive elements. To overcome this problem, a new path delay test generation algorithm is developed for custom designs. The results using benchmark circuits and real designs prove the efficiency of the new algorithm. The new test generation algorithm can be applied to designs employing intellectual property (IP) circuits whose implementation details are either unknown or unavailable.

  • The problem of architecting a reliable transport system across an overlay network using split TCP connections as the transport primitive is mainly considered. The considered overlay network uses the application-level switch in each intermediate host. We first argue that natural designs based on store-and-forward principles that are maintained by split TCP connections of hop-by-hop approaches. These approaches in overlay networks do not concern end-to-end TCP semantics. Then, a new transport protocol-Overlay Transport Protocol (OTP)-that manages the end-to-end connection and is responsible for the congestion/flow control between source host and destination host is proposed. The proposed network model for the congestion and flow control mechanisms uses a new window size-Ownd-and a new timer in the source host and destination host. We validate our analytical findings and evaluate the performance of our OTP using a prototype implementation via simulation.

  • While prior work has noted the importance of knowledge creation in gaining competitive advantages, much less is understood about why firms do not actually use what they create. Building upon institutional approaches to organization studies, we offer a new framework to explain the gap between knowledge creation and utilization. We test our framework in an empirical context of sustainable innovation and environmental technologies where ideas of environmental sustainability have recently gained public popularity and shaped how interested audiences make evaluative assessments of firms. In such a context, firms are apt to perceive the social attention toward sustainability to be a normative pressure, which causes them to create new knowledge and develop technologies consistent with the pressure. Using data from the government-initiated certification system for green technologies, our study finds that firms do not always fully implement new environmental technologies they develop in response to the certification program, the situation we refer to as knowledge decoupling. We also examine a set of conditions under which knowledge decoupling becomes more or less amplified. Taken together, our findings show how a firm's knowledge creation and utilization is shaped by its external institutional environment as well as internal learning processes.

  • Purpose: This paper analyzed the historical origins of the Qi concept and assesses its possible contribution to the development of complementary therapy and new nursing practices. Methods: In order to clarify the Qi concept measure its theoretical/clinical potentials, this study analyzed both historical data and experimental research that adopt and apply the concept. These include modern/contemporary research measuring its effects in promoting mental and physical health. Using the method of cross-cultural comparison, this study analyzed diverse approaches to the Qi concept and sought to find common features among the approaches. Results: A historical, cross-cultural analysis revealed several fundamental similarities between Qi theories that have developed in the east and the holistic concepts that have evolved in the western traditions. Especially, the analysis of the more recent research on the Qi concept shows ample possibilities of its future contributions to the development of new diagnostic applications and the promotion of overall human health. Conclusion: The historical study of the Qi concept found some key common factors in the diverse philosophical traditions in the east and the west. Considering the growing popularity of complementary therapy among health professionals and the general public, the Qi concept and its clinical applications are expected to promote human health. In this context, this research contributes to developing new nursing practices based on the concept by clarifying its philosophical origins and theoretical backgrounds.
